Technology Development of Fully Automatic Can Capping Machine
The new rotary automatic capping machine is a device used for automatic capping of glass jars. It installs an electromagnetic friction clutch on the shaft sleeve and automatically adjusts the tightening force through the control circuit. The capping head shaft is automatically raised and lowered to clamp and release the bottle cap. According to the sealing requirements of different round can types, the working parameters can be easily designed and changed on the touch screen. The single-fold edge sealing is the same as the edge pressing operation of the head and tail sealing wheels, so that the flange of the tank body overlaps and bends with the hook edge of the tank cover, and is compressed and sealed to form a tight five-layer tinplate structure. The sealing wheel mainly causes the can body flange and the can lid hook edge to be fully bent and hooked in the overlapping state, and the second sealing wheel applies pressure after the initial seal is formed to achieve a tight seal. The symmetrical structure of the sealing wheel of the channel and the second channel makes the sealing quality of the large tank more stable. Equipped with a vacuum system to evacuate the tank, eliminating the need for an exhaust box, reducing product costs and extending the shelf life of the tank.
